Understanding the Evolution of Climate Forecasting

Climate forecasting has come a long way since its inception. Traditional methods relied heavily on statistical models and historical data. However, the advent of advanced computational techniques and vast datasets has revolutionized the field. Today, we see a blend of machine learning, artificial intelligence, and big data analytics being used to enhance the accuracy and reliability of climate forecasts.

Key Innovations:

1. Machine Learning Models: These models can analyze large volumes of data to identify patterns and trends that are not easily discernible through traditional methods. They help in predicting extreme weather events with greater precision.

2. Artificial Intelligence (AI): AI-driven tools can process real-time data from multiple sources, such as satellite imagery, weather stations, and ocean buoys, to provide near-instantaneous updates on climate conditions.

3. Big Data Analytics: The integration of big data technologies allows for the analysis of complex and diverse datasets, leading to more comprehensive and accurate forecasts.

Case Study: Agriculture Sector

In the agricultural sector, accurate climate forecasts can help farmers plan their crop cycles, manage water resources, and predict pest outbreaks. For instance, a company might use machine learning algorithms to predict drought conditions, allowing them to adjust irrigation schedules and prevent crop losses.

Energy Sector

In the energy sector, climate forecasts are crucial for managing renewable energy resources. By predicting solar and wind conditions, utilities can optimize their energy generation and storage systems, ensuring a stable supply of power.

Future Developments and Emerging Trends

Looking ahead, the field of climate forecasting is poised for further advancements. Emerging trends include the integration of IoT (Internet of Things) devices, more sophisticated satellite technologies, and the development of more user-friendly decision-support systems.

IoT and Sensor Networks:

The proliferation of IoT devices and sensor networks is providing real-time, high-resolution data on climate variables. This data can be used to create more localized and precise forecasts, which are particularly valuable for urban planning and public health initiatives.

Satellite Technology:

Advancements in satellite technology are improving the resolution and accuracy of climate data. High-resolution images and data from new satellite missions can provide detailed insights into climate patterns and changes, which can be crucial for long-term planning.

User-Friendly Decision-Support Systems:

As the complexity of climate data increases, there is a growing need for user-friendly decision-support systems. These tools can help non-specialists understand and interpret climate forecasts, making them more accessible and actionable for a wide range of stakeholders.
